Understanding the Role of an Eviction Paralegal in Mississauga

An Eviction Paralegal in Mississauga specializes in representing landlords seeking to remove tenants through legal means. Mississauga, with its growing rental market and high tenant turnover, presents a complex legal environment. Paralegals in this city are highly familiar with the intricacies of tenant non-compliance, rent arrears, illegal activities, and damage to property cases.

Services Provided by Eviction Paralegals in Mississauga

  • Preparation of Eviction Notices (Form N4, N5, N6, N7, etc.)

  • Filing applications to the LTB (Form L1, L2)

  • Representation at LTB hearings

  • Negotiation and mediation with tenants

  • Enforcement of LTB orders through the Sheriff’s Office

  • Advisory on rights and obligations under the Residential Tenancies Act (RTA)

These professionals are experts in non-payment evictions, persistent late rent, illegal activity, and serious interference with reasonable enjoyment, which are common challenges in urban rental hubs like Mississauga.

What to Expect During a Consultation

Whether you're meeting an Eviction Paralegal in Mississauga or a Landlord Paralegal in Markham, here’s what a typical consultation includes:

  • Review of tenancy agreements and RTA obligations

  • Identification of legal breaches or tenant violations

  • Discussion of LTB application timelines and hearing strategies

  • Exploration of mediation or settlement options

  • Guidance on enforcement post-judgment

Make sure to bring documentation, correspondence, and prior notices to ensure the paralegal can provide informed, specific advice.
